United States > Finance > Capital markets: debt offerings
(Next Generation Partners)Ropes & Gray LLP’s reputation in the DCM market is very much in the ascendancy. Having grown its New York team over the last five years, it brought in Faiza Rahman from Weil, Gotshal & Manges LLP and Daniel Forman from Proskauer Rose LLP in April 2022 to further cement the firm’s standing in the city and nationwide. The team is noted for its advice to private equity houses and other fund managers, and also sees high levels of engagements from underwriters. Paul Tropp co-heads the capital markets group from the Boston office and frequently represents underwriters in investment grade offerings by private equity funds, credit funds and business development companies (BDCs). Boston’s Craig Marcus and New York partner Christopher Capuzzi are also key partners.
United States > Finance > Capital markets: equity offerings
Ropes & Gray LLP has earned a significant market share of the SPAC IPO segment and frequently advises private equity houses and their portfolio companies on their equity offerings. It is also particularly known for its representation of underwriters. With the slowdown in IPO activity, the firm has remained active in follow-on offerings, at-the-market offerings and PIPE financings. New York partner Paul Tropp co-heads the capital markets team alongside Craig Marcus, who splits his time between Boston and New York. New York’s Rachel Phillips, Christopher Capuzzi and Faiza Rahman are all emerging talents.
